STRONG'S WORD STUDY

H7878 — שִׂיחַ

si.ach · to muse · Hebrew/Aramaic

1) to put forth, mediate, muse, commune, speak, complain, ponder, sing 1a) (Qal) 1a1) to complain 1a2) to muse, meditate upon, study, ponder 1a3) to talk, sing, speak 1b) (Polel) to meditate, consider, put forth thoughts
